Position Summary The Mechanical Engineer is responsible for the design, documentation, sourcing, manufacturing readiness, testing, and continuous improvement of the company’s automation products. This role serves as a primary technical owner of the physical product portfolio and works closely with contract engineering resources, contract manufacturers, suppliers, internal teams, and customers to ensure products are well-designed, properly documented, manufacturable, reliable, cost-effective, and ready for deployment at scale. The ideal candidate combines strong mechanical and product engineering fundamentals with practical experience in manufacturing, supplier management, testing, and new product introduction. Key Responsibilities Product Development & Design — 30% Own the technical design and ongoing development of the company’s automation products. Utilize and coordinate contract engineering resources to support immediate and specialized product design requirements. Maintain ownership of all product drawings, specifications, bills of material, engineering documentation, and revision control. Ensure product documentation remains accurate and reflects the current production configuration. Analyze existing products and recommend improvements related to reliability, manufacturability, cost, serviceability, performance, and installation. Lead engineering changes and ensure updates are properly communicated to suppliers, manufacturing partners, and internal stakeholders. Lead new product introduction initiatives from initial concept through production readiness. Manufacturing & Sourcing — 30% Prepare and maintain the documentation required to successfully manufacture company products. Ensure smooth handoff of new products and engineering changes into production. Develop manufacturing requirements, assembly instructions, inspection criteria, and supporting technical documentation. Manage external product sourcing and supplier relationships. Identify, evaluate, and qualify suppliers based on technical capability, quality, cost, lead time, capacity, and supply-chain risk. Coordinate with contract manufacturers and external partners to ensure production activities align with company requirements and objectives. Support supplier negotiations, cost-reduction initiatives, and ongoing vendor performance management. Lead the transition and onshoring of selected components and subassemblies. Evaluate onshoring opportunities based on total landed cost, quality, capacity, supply-chain resilience, and operational risk. Support production ramp activities and resolve manufacturing issues as they arise. Testing & Quality Assurance — 20% Own product testing and validation activities, including testing and burn-in procedures performed at the Waltham facility. Develop and maintain test procedures, acceptance criteria, and product validation documentation. Ensure products meet defined requirements for performance, reliability, quality, safety, and regulatory compliance. Analyze product failures and lead root-cause investigations and corrective actions. Work with suppliers and manufacturing partners to resolve recurring quality issues. Use testing and field-performance data to identify opportunities for continuous product improvement. Establish appropriate quality controls for incoming components, manufacturing, final assembly, and product release. Client & Partner Engagement — 10% Participate in customer and partner discussions when technical product expertise is required. Provide technical guidance regarding product capabilities, limitations, configuration, and implementation requirements. Support internal teams during solution development and project planning. Collaborate with engineering, realization, sales, operations, and project teams to ensure proposed solutions can be successfully delivered. Work directly with suppliers, contract manufacturers, integrators, and other external stakeholders to resolve technical issues. Product Lifecycle & Continuous Improvement — 10% Maintain technical ownership of products throughout their lifecycle. Support engineering change control, documentation management, configuration management, and product revision tracking. Monitor product performance in production and in the field. Identify opportunities for cost reduction, component standardization, design simplification, and reliability improvement. Evaluate component obsolescence and supply-chain risks and develop appropriate replacement strategies. Support long-term product roadmap and product lifecycle planning.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Manufacturing Engineering, or a related technical field. 5+ years of experience in mechanical engineering, product engineering, manufacturing engineering, robotics, industrial automation, material handling, or a related industry. Experience taking products from design through manufacturing and production release. Strong understanding of engineering drawings, bills of material, tolerances, specifications, and revision control. Experience working with contract manufacturers, suppliers, and outsourced engineering resources. Demonstrated experience with new product introduction and manufacturing readiness. Experience with product testing, validation, failure analysis, and root-cause investigation. Strong understanding of design for manufacturing and assembly principles.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Strong written and verbal communication skills. Preferred Characteristics The successful candidate will be someone who: Takes ownership of the product rather than simply completing individual engineering tasks. Is comfortable working directly with suppliers, manufacturers, engineers, and customers. Can move easily between detailed engineering work and broader product-level decision-making. Has a strong bias toward practical, manufacturable solutions. Understands the relationship between engineering decisions, product cost, quality, and operational performance. Is highly organized and disciplined regarding engineering documentation and change management. Is willing to investigate failures and technical problems until the root cause is understood. Can effectively coordinate outsourced engineering resources while maintaining internal ownership of product knowledge. Looks continuously for opportunities to simplify products, reduce cost, improve reliability, and strengthen the supply chain. Travel & Work Schedule Periodic travel to suppliers, contract manufacturers, customer locations, and partner facilities will be required. The position may require occasional non‑standard working hours to support testing, manufacturing activities, production issues, or project requirements. Regular presence at the Waltham facility will be required to support product testing, validation, and burn-in activities. #J-18808-Ljbffr The Home Depot
